第一步:安裝JRE 和 Eclipse
詳細步驟請參考:http://blog.csdn.net/ex_net/article/details/7251664
第二步:安裝arm-linux-gcc 和 arm-linux-g++
(1)復制 arm-linux-gcc-4.3.2.tgz 到 /home/tools 目錄下,然后解壓縮到 根目錄下 /
# tar -xvzf arm-linux-gcc-4.3.2.tgz -C /
(2)修改環境變量
# gedit /etc/environment
向該配置文件加入::/usr/local/arm/4.3.2/bin
(3)重新啟動Ubuntu系統(注銷當前用戶,重新登錄也可以)
(4)檢測 arm-linux-gcc 編譯工具是否正確安裝
# arm-linux-gcc -v
如果能正確看到上面的信息,說明你的編譯工具已經安裝正確。
第三步:配置Eclipse
(1)打開Eclipse,並新建一個C/C++工程
然后一路Next即可。
(2)設置剛剛新建的工程屬性,鼠標右鍵點擊【Test1】項目
(4)新建一個工程管理配置信息
(5)設置 剛剛新建的ARM配置信息
選擇ARM后,此處的 GCC C++ Compiler、GCC C Compiler、GCC C++ Linker、GCC Assembler的Command依次修改
(6)測試arm-linux-gcc編譯
再次點擊 Build Project
查看編譯結果,提示Build Finished,沒有任何錯誤。
第四步:將剛剛編譯好的程序下載到開發板上,例如6410開發板上。
用telnet 192.168.0.XX 先登錄上開發板
然后掛接NFS目錄
PC 電腦上
安裝NFS可以用 #sudo dpkg --clear-avail && sudo apt-get update #sudo apt-get install nfs-common nfs-kernel-server portmap |
例如:mount -t nfs -o nolock 192.168.0.176:/home /mnt/disk/nfs
然后進入 Test1目錄下的ARM目錄,執行程序
運行的結果:
至此我們的第1個測試程序已經成功了!
from:http://blog.csdn.net/zjianbo/article/details/7251845